Charlie McCoy's 'You Were Always on My Mind' had a release date set for August 1, 2018. With this song being around four minutes long, at 3:51, the duration of this song is pretty average compared to other songs. This track is safe for children and doesn't appear to contain any foul language, since the "Explicit" tag was not present in this track. The song is number 2 out of 13 in Country Gold by Charlie McCoy. Going off of the ISRC code of this track, we detected that the origin of this track is from United States. You Were Always on My Mind is below average in popularity right now. Although the tone can be danceable to some, this track does projects more of a negative sound rather than a postive one.
The tempo marking of You Were Always on My Mind by Charlie McCoy is Adagio (slowly with great expression), since this song has a tempo of 71 BPM. With that information, we can conclude that the song has a slow tempo. The time signature for this track is 4/4.
E Major is the music key of this track. This also means that this song has a camelot key of 12B. So, the perfect camelot match for 12B would be either 12B or 1A.
